Parc Mario Japan is this vibrant, whimsical wonderland that feels like stepping straight into a Nintendo game! The main draw is the Super Nintendo World section, where you can race against friends in the real-life version of 'Mario Kart' on the Bowser’s Challenge ride—complete with AR visors that make shells and bananas fly at you. The attention to detail is insane; even the power-up blocks spin when you hit them!

Then there’s Yoshi’s Adventure, a slow-paced ride through Mushroom Kingdom’s landscapes, perfect for younger kids or nostalgia-heavy adults like me. The park’s interactive Power-Up Bands let you collect digital coins by tapping sensors scattered around, adding a gamified layer to exploring. Don’t miss the themed food either—the Mario-shaped burgers and question block tiramisu are as Instagrammable as they are tasty. I left grinning like I’d won a star.

If you’re a theme park enthusiast, Parc Mario Japan is pure dopamine. The headline attraction, Super Nintendo World, is a masterclass in immersion. Walking through the green pipes into Peach’s Castle gave me chills—it’s like the games materialized in 3D. The rides are inventive; Bowser’s Castle mixes physical sets with augmented reality for a chaotic, fun experience. But what surprised me were the smaller touches: Piranha Plants snoring in corners, Thwomps looming overhead, and even hidden Easter eggs referencing deeper cuts like 'Luigi’s Mansion.'

The land’s compact size makes it feel dense with magic, though peak hours can get crowded. Pro tip: snag an early entry ticket to photograph the empty park—it’s surreal. Also, the merchandise is next-level; I still wear my '1-Up' socks weekly. Universal’s nailed the balance between thrill rides and pure, childlike joy here.

Where Does Princess Rosalina Appear In Mario Galaxy?

1 Answers2026-04-10 19:25:45
Princess Rosalina is one of those characters who just feels magical the moment she appears, and her role in 'Super Mario Galaxy' is no exception. She first shows up in the game as the guardian of the Comet Observatory, a floating hub that serves as the central point for Mario's cosmic adventures. From the very beginning, her quiet, gentle demeanor stands out—she’s not your typical princess waiting to be rescued. Instead, she’s this enigmatic, almost maternal figure who watches over the Lumas, those adorable star-like creatures. Her backstory, revealed through the storybook sequences, adds so much depth to her character. It’s rare for a 'Mario' game to dive into something so melancholic yet beautiful, and Rosalina’s tale of loss, found family, and cosmic responsibility really sticks with you. Her physical appearances in the game are scattered but meaningful. She’s often seen in the Observatory’s library, where she shares fragments of her story. The way she interacts with Mario is subtle but impactful—she guides him without overtly directing him, almost like a silent ally. One of the most memorable moments is when she uses her powers to help Mario traverse the universe, like when she repairs the Observatory’s dome or aids in the final battle against Bowser. It’s these touches that make her feel integral to the game’s heart, not just a decorative addition. And let’s not forget her playable appearance in the sequel, 'Super Mario Galaxy 2,' where she becomes a fully controllable character in certain levels. But in the first game, she’s more of a guiding presence, and that’s part of what makes her so special—she’s not there to steal the spotlight, but to quietly enrich the story. Mario Vs Crash: Who Has Better Platforming Skills?

2 Answers2026-04-25 17:24:44
Mario's platforming skills are legendary, and for good reason. From the pixel-perfect jumps in 'Super Mario Bros.' to the gravity-defying flips in 'Super Mario Galaxy,' Nintendo has refined his mechanics over decades to feel intuitive yet challenging. What I love about Mario is how his movement evolves with each game—whether it's the long jump in 'Mario 64' or the wall kicks in 'Odyssey,' there's always something new to master. Crash Bandicoot, while fun, feels heavier and more deliberate, with spins and slides that lack the same fluidity. Mario's versatility in handling different terrains—ice, sand, even upside-down—gives him an edge. And let's not forget speedrunning: Mario's physics allow for insane tricks like 'backward long jumps,' while Crash's levels often rely on memorization rather than pure skill. That said, Crash has his charm. The 'Crash Bandicoot' series leans into precision and timing, especially in the remastered trilogy, where the hitboxes feel tighter. But compared to Mario's seamless integration of momentum and control, Crash sometimes feels like he's fighting the camera or awkward angles. Mario's games are designed around player expression—you can stomp, bounce, or flutter through levels in countless ways. Crash? You mostly survive. It's a different kind of thrill, but for pure platforming prowess, Mario's the GOAT.
